How to cook fully cooked ham on a gas grill?

A good rule of thumb is 12-15 minutes per pound, when staying between 225-250 degrees for pre-cooked ham. Monitor the temperature with your iGrill. Be sure to set the glaze for 10-15 minutes before removing the ham from the grill.

Can you heat a spiral ham on the grill?

Use indirect heat With the spiral cut ham, keep the pieces wrapped as much as possible and protect the ham from direct heat. To prevent the end from drying out, place the ham cut side down on a sheet of aluminum foil. This will help retain moisture while exposing the skin to the heat and taste of the grill.

How long does it take to make a 12 pound ham?

The cooking time for fresh ham varies greatly depending on the size. In a 325 degree oven, the ham with a bone weighs 12 to 16 pounds and takes 22 to 26 minutes per pound. A 10 to 14 pound boneless ham takes 24 to 28 minutes per pound. A ham with a bone of 5 to 8 pounds and takes 35 to 40 minutes.

How to reheat a ham with a spiral of 10 pounds?

Preheat the oven to 250°F. Remove the wrapper and if your ham has a small plastic disc on the underside of the bone, remove it and discard the disc. Put the ham in a shallow baking sheet, cut it. Bake for 13 to 16 minutes per pound until the ham reaches 140°F.

How long do you heat a fully cooked spiral ham?

Preheat the ham Preheat the oven to 275°F. Remove all packaging materials and place ham face down directly in a baking dish or baking sheet. (Set aside all of the ham.) Cover tightly with a lid, foil, or place in a cooking bag and heat to 275°F for about 12-15 minutes per pound.

What is the best way to prepare ham?

How to Bake Ham If you’re starting with fully cooked urban ham, bake it at 350 degrees F for about 10 minutes per pound. To keep the ham moist and juicy, place it cut side down in a baking sheet and cover with foil. Every 20 minutes, coat the ham with the glaze and coat it with the pan juices.

Should the ham be covered when cooking?

Roasting ham uncovered It’s best to heat ham slowly and slowly, and if you heat it uncovered, it means that the moisture in the ham evaporates, leaving it dry and unappetizing. Follow these tips: Place the ham cut side down in a baking sheet. Cover the ham with foil or use a cooking bag to heat the ham until it is time to glaze.
